Which of the following is essential for ensuring data integrity?

Explanation:
Implementing encryption measures is vital for ensuring data integrity because encryption transforms data into a format that cannot be easily read or altered without the appropriate decryption keys. When sensitive information is encrypted, it safeguards the data from unauthorized access and tampering, helping to maintain its accuracy and reliability over time. This means that even if data is intercepted, it remains protected and unchanged, which is essential for maintaining trust in the information being processed or transmitted. While the other options contribute to overall security and risk management, they do not focus directly on maintaining the integrity of the data itself in the same way that encryption does. Regularly changing passwords enhances authentication but does not by itself ensure integrity. Minimizing user access reduces risk but does not protect data if it is compromised. Conducting employee training increases awareness and security best practices but does not directly affect data integrity. Therefore, encryption stands out as a crucial method specifically targeting the assurance of data integrity.
